RPC VI, 5631 (temporary)

 

Image of specimen #9

 

Coin type
Volume VI
Number 5631 (temporary)
Province Asia
Subprovince Conventus of Apamea
Region Phrygia
City Bruzus
Reign Uncertain
Issue Boule
Dating Maximinus–Gordian III
Obverse inscription ΒΟΥΛΗ
Obverse design veiled and draped bust of Boule, r.
Reverse inscription ΒΡΟΥΖΗΝΩΝ
Reverse design Poseidon standing facing, head r., holding dolphin and trident, placing foot on prow
Metal Æ
Average diameter 23 mm
Axis 6, 12
Reference Martin 160,2
Specimens 9 (5 in the core collections)
